Dooya and Somfy Wireless: различия между версиями
(не показаны 3 промежуточные версии этого же участника) | |||
Строка 2: | Строка 2: | ||
[[Image: RF-Blinds.png |300px|thumb|right| Модуль RF-Blinds ]] | [[Image: RF-Blinds.png |300px|thumb|right| Модуль RF-Blinds ]] | ||
== Общая информация == | == Общая информация == | ||
Для подключения используется модуль расширения RF-Blinds, который устанавливается в корпус контроллера и настраивается в веб-интерфейсе. Сделать это можно по аналогии с другими радиомодулями, например, [[WBE2R-R-LORA_v.1_Extension_Module]]. | Для подключения используется модуль расширения RF-Blinds, который устанавливается в корпус контроллера и настраивается в веб-интерфейсе. Сделать это можно по аналогии с другими радиомодулями, например, [[WBE2R-R-LORA_v.1_Extension_Module | WBE2R-R-LORA]]. | ||
При конфигурировании выберите из списка '''Интерфейс UART (DIY)'''. | При конфигурировании выберите из списка '''Интерфейс UART (DIY)'''. | ||
Строка 19: | Строка 19: | ||
[[Файл:Blinds-rf-module minicom answer.png|300px|thumb|right|Ответ модуля]] | [[Файл:Blinds-rf-module minicom answer.png|300px|thumb|right|Ответ модуля]] | ||
После того как модуль сконфгурирован, его нужно настроить — перечень команд | После того, как модуль сконфгурирован, его нужно настроить — перечень команд и инструкцию по настройке вы найдёте на странице [https://breelek.gitlab.io/blinds-rf-module/ Описание команд радиомодуля]. | ||
Подключимся к модулю и отправим команду help: | Подключимся к модулю и отправим команду help: | ||
Строка 32: | Строка 32: | ||
help | help | ||
</syntaxhighlight> | </syntaxhighlight> | ||
#Если | #Если модуль работает, то он пришлёт ответ: | ||
#:<syntaxhighlight lang="bash"> | #:<syntaxhighlight lang="bash"> | ||
Description of the commands posted on the site | Description of the commands posted on the site |
Текущая версия на 19:43, 22 сентября 2022
Общая информация
Для подключения используется модуль расширения RF-Blinds, который устанавливается в корпус контроллера и настраивается в веб-интерфейсе. Сделать это можно по аналогии с другими радиомодулями, например, WBE2R-R-LORA.
При конфигурировании выберите из списка Интерфейс UART (DIY).
Настройка модуля
Параметры порта
Модуль работает по UART.
Значение по умолчанию |
Название параметра в веб-интерфейсе |
Параметр |
---|---|---|
115200 | Baud rate | Скорость, бит/с |
8 | Data bits | Количество битов данных |
None | Parity | Бит чётности |
1 | Stop bits | Количество стоповых битов |
Настройка
После того, как модуль сконфгурирован, его нужно настроить — перечень команд и инструкцию по настройке вы найдёте на странице Описание команд радиомодуля.
Подключимся к модулю и отправим команду help:
- Откройте консоль контроллера по SSH.
- Подключитесь к модулю с помощью minicom, для этого выполните команду:
minicom -D /dev/ttyMOD4 -b 115200 -8 -a off
- где /dev/ttyMOD4 — порт разъема расширения, в который вставлен модуль.
- Введите команду, вводимые символы не отображаются:
help
- Если модуль работает, то он пришлёт ответ:
Description of the commands posted on the site https://breelek.gitlab.io/blinds-rf-module/ OK
Представление в веб-интерфейсе
Установка пакета
Для работы с модулем установите пакет wb-mqtt-rfblinds:
apt update && apt install wb-mqtt-rfblinds -y
Создание правила
Предположим, что модуль вставлен в порт /dev/ttyMOD4
, а подключаем мы привод Dooya с групповым адресом 1, а индивидуальным — 3:
- Перейдите на вкладку Правила.
- Откройте файл
rf-blinds.js
. - Добавьте в конец файла строки:
- Настройка порта
rfblinds.add_serial_port('/dev/ttyMOD4')
- Инициализация привода:
rfblinds.add_dooya(1, 2, 'DOOYA test device')
- Настройка порта
- Сохраните правило, на вкладке Устройства должно появиться виртуальное устройство DOOYA test device.
Настройка лимита
Перед использованием желательно настроить крайние положения. Процедуру настройки смотрите в документации на ваше устройство.
Полезные ссылки